Quarry <br />M-85-043 ~ zi~~ <br />Enclosed is a modified map identified as Exhibit E-1 <br />to support our plan to dispose of waste rock material within <br />the the permitted area of the Red Canyon Quarry. <br />I have identified the location of the intermittent <br />streambed located to the west of the boundary of the site. <br />No waste material or run-off from the waste pile will enter <br />the water-way. Due to the course size and shape of the waste <br />rock material which now makes up part of the northen end of <br />the area identified as the "unworked ledge", I am confident <br />any additional waste material can be stablized in the embank- <br />ment at a 2:1 grade. There is little if any evidence of <br />erosion or cutting in the old embankment now in place even <br />in areas that are too steep to climb. <br />I believe this map and letter responds to your questions <br />raised in our recent telephone conversation.
